Join us as a Territory Sales Manager, where you'll grow our business in containers, ground-level offices, modular structures, and value-added solutions. As a Territory Sales Manager, you will develop and execute strategic sales plans, focusing on prospecting, lead conversion, and maintaining a healthy sales pipeline. You will build long-term customer relationships through regular communication and exceptional service, using Salesforce CRM to manage performance and interactions. Staying informed on market trends and competitors, you will provide consultative selling solutions, prepare competitive quotes, and negotiate terms to maximize profitability. Collaboration with cross-functional teams is essential to ensure seamless project execution, along with maintaining accurate sales records and meeting performance goals through effective time management in a fast-paced environment. Key Responsibilities of This Role Include: Sales Growth & Prospecting:
Develop and implement strategic sales plans, focusing on outbound prospecting (80%) and inbound lead conversion (20%). Pipeline Management:
Maintain and expand a sales pipeline by identifying prospects and market segments, converting leads into high-value projects. Customer Relationships:
Build strong partnerships by understanding customer needs, recommending tailored solutions, and providing exceptional service. Use Salesforce CRM for tracking. Market & Product Analysis:
Stay updated on industry trends and competitors. Conduct research to identify growth opportunities. Consultative Selling:
Employ a consultative approach for pricing and solutions, preparing accurate quotes and negotiating terms. Performance Reporting:
Use CRM to maintain records and generate reports, tracking key metrics to meet goals. Team Collaboration:
Work closely with operations and support teams to ensure a seamless customer experience, providing leadership when needed.
What You Possess for Success: Persistent & Driven: Committed to results and motivated by targets. Customer-centric: Focused on understanding and meeting customer needs. Adaptable & Resilient: Able to thrive in a dynamic environment, managing time effectively. Tech-Savvy: Comfortable with CRM systems like Salesforce and tracking performance.
Skills & Experience:
High school diploma, GED, or equivalent; 1+ year outbound prospecting or sales experience, or 1+ year at WillScot. Ability to travel 10-20% for field visits; role based in the branch with ~80% outbound cold-calling. Strong communication skills (written and verbal). Proficient in Microsoft Office, Teams, and Zoom. Experience with high-volume, transactional sales cycles. Leasing experience is a plus but not required. A consultative, solution-selling approach is advantageous.
